Medically, the number of a person’s breath depends on many factors: age, physical condition, activity, to emotions. Babies can breathe 30-60 times per minute, while adults are in a break of breathing 12-20 times per minute. That is, the average human can breathe around 17,000 to 30,000 times per dayEven more if you are active.

The number of breaths a day and night according to the ulama
In the book ‘A ḥnyiyat As-Sarqwwwī’ a 10mentioned:
Some of them say: Everyone breathes every day and one night from one hundred thousand people and twenty -four thousand moderate people, and in every moderate soul, a thousand dead and a thousand born, and the mothers carry a thousand, and in it one hundred thousand close virtues.
That is, “Some scholars say: Every human breathing a day and night as many as 124,000 average breathing (mu’tadil breath). In each of these breaths, there are 100,000 deaths, 100,000 births, 100,000 pregnancies, and for Allah there are 100,000 proceeds (furuj) close.” (Ḥāsyiyat al-Sharqāwī ‘Al-Hudhudī, p. 68, ṭ. Maktabah al-ḥaramayn)
This statement is certainly not a medical count, but Sufism and symbolic expressions who invited humans to realize that Every second of our lives is in a complicated and full secret of the Divine Destiny Network.
Other versions of Tanbīhul Ghīn and Director Nāiihi
Other books call different numbers, but still mean in. In Tanbīul ghāfilīn and addictive Durner Nāiihn Page 260, mentioned:
It is said, the hours throughout the day and that day are twenty and twenty, for someone breathing every hundred eighty breaths. At night and night, he breathed four thousand three hundred and twenty people. And in each soul asked with two questions when out and time entering.
Meaning: “It is said that day and night consist of 24 hours. Humans breathe every hour as much as 180 times. So, in a day and night, humans breathe as much as 4,320 times. And in every breath, humans will be asked two questions: when inhaling and when inhaling – what do you do to both?”
This number looks smaller than the medical standard, even far from the number 124,000 mentioned earlier. But the point is not on exact numberbut Ibrah value which contains it.
Why is it different in number? There is a wisdom behind it
When we look at it, the scholars like not focused on quantitative accuracybut use numbers as a symbol for spiritual awareness. Especially in the quote of the book Sharqawi, mentioned:
… some of them say
“Some scholars say …”
Which means this statement is not ijma ‘(mujma’ ‘alaih), and is wisdom or metaphorist.
There is also a possibility The breath count is counted twicenamely one to enter and one to exit. This might explain why the numbers in the book can be far greater than the results of medical observations.
